Smackdown Results/Spoilers 12/07/13

    Daniel Bryan defeats Christian via Yes! Lock.
    Seth Rollins defeats Jey Uso with Roman Reigns and Jimmy Uso at ringside.
    Chris Jericho defeats Curtis Axel via count out. Axel flips out and attacks the announcer's table after the match.
    Ryback defeats The Miz via Meat Hook lariat.
    Divas brawl at a contract signing with Big E Langston and The Great Khali.
    Fandango defeats Wade Barrett via pinfall.
    The Wyatt Family cuts a promo, explaining their attack on Kane from Monday Night Raw.
    Alberto Del Rio versus Sin Cara is a no-contest. It was Dolph Ziggler who dressed as Sin Cara, thus attacking Del Rio.
    Randy Orton versus Sheamus ends in a no-contest due to interference by Daniel Bryan. Christian comes out to set up a four-man brawl, with Orton eventually hitting the RKO and retrieving the Money in the Bank briefcase.
